Defining Uracil Synthesis

Uracil synthesis refers to the chemical processes used to create uracil (C₄H₄N₂O₂), a pyrimidine nucleobase found in RNA. While uracil is naturally present in living organisms, the demand for large quantities necessitates its artificial production. This typically involves multi-step chemical reactions starting from readily available precursors.

The synthesis isn’t a single, standardized process. Different synthetic routes exist, each with its advantages and disadvantages regarding yield, cost, and environmental impact. These routes often involve variations in catalysts, solvents, and reaction conditions to optimize the final product's purity and quantity.

Ultimately, successful uracil synthesis results in a highly purified compound suitable for use in diverse applications, ranging from basic research to the manufacturing of complex pharmaceuticals. The ability to precisely control the synthetic process is vital to ensuring the quality and reliability of downstream applications.

Key Factors in Effective Uracil Synthesis

Several factors directly influence the efficiency and viability of uracil synthesis. Yield is a primary concern; maximizing the amount of uracil produced from given starting materials is crucial for economic feasibility. Closely related is Purity, as contaminants can interfere with subsequent applications and require costly purification steps.

Cost-Effectiveness is a significant driver of research, pushing for cheaper precursors and more efficient catalysts. Scalability is equally important, ensuring that laboratory-scale syntheses can be adapted for large-scale industrial production to meet market demands. Finally, Environmental Sustainability, including minimizing waste and using eco-friendly solvents, is becoming increasingly paramount.

Optimizing these factors often involves a trade-off. For example, a synthesis offering very high yield may necessitate the use of expensive catalysts, impacting the overall cost-effectiveness. Finding the optimal balance between these factors is key to developing a commercially viable and environmentally responsible synthesize uracil process.

Future Trends in Uracil Synthesis

The future of uracil synthesis is likely to be shaped by advancements in biocatalysis and flow chemistry. Biocatalysis, utilizing enzymes to catalyze reactions, offers highly selective and environmentally friendly synthesis routes. Flow chemistry, performing reactions in continuous flow systems, enhances scalability and process control.

Furthermore, the integration of machine learning and artificial intelligence is expected to accelerate the discovery of novel catalysts and optimize reaction conditions. These technologies will allow for more efficient and targeted uracil synthesis, meeting the demands of an ever-evolving scientific landscape.

How does the purity level impact the application of synthesized uracil?

Purity is crucial. Higher purity levels (typically >99%) are essential for sensitive applications like RNA sequencing, oligonucleotide synthesis, and pharmaceutical formulations. Impurities can interfere with reactions, leading to inaccurate results or adverse effects. Lower purity grades may be suitable for less demanding applications, such as some research experiments where precise results aren’t paramount.

What safety precautions should be taken when handling synthesized uracil?

Uracil is generally considered a low-toxicity chemical, but it's still important to handle it with care. W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) such as gloves, safety glasses, and a lab coat. Avoid inhalation of dust and contact with skin and eyes. Refer to the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S) for detailed safety information and handling guidelines.

Can uracil be synthesized with isotopic labels (e.g., 13C, 15N)?

Yes, uracil can be synthesized with stable isotopic labels. Isotopically labeled uracil is widely used in metabolic studies, NMR spectroscopy, and other research applications. However, this process is significantly more complex and expensive than standard synthesis. It requires specialized precursors and analytical techniques to ensure accurate isotopic incorporation.

What are the common storage conditions for synthesized uracil?

Synthesized uracil should be stored in a tightly sealed container, protected from light and moisture. Long-term storage is best achieved at refrigerated temperatures (2-8°C) or even frozen (-20°C). Proper storage helps maintain purity and prevents degradation over time. Check the product specifications for specific storage recommendations from the supplier.
